Free and Open-Source 3D Modeling Software: Powerful Options Without the Price Tag

For those of you just starting out or on a tight budget, the world of free and open-source 3D modeling software is a treasure trove of powerful tools. These options often pack a surprising punch, offering features comparable to their commercial counterparts. Let's dive into some of the top contenders. Blender is arguably the king of the free 3D modeling world. This powerhouse is a fully-featured suite that can handle everything from modeling and sculpting to animation, rendering, and even video editing. It’s used by hobbyists, indie developers, and even professional studios. The learning curve can be a bit steep initially, but the vast online community and extensive tutorials make it incredibly accessible. You'll find countless resources, from beginner guides to advanced techniques, to help you master Blender's capabilities. Its versatility is a major selling point; whether you're creating characters, environments, or visual effects, Blender has you covered. The fact that it’s open-source means it's constantly evolving and improving, driven by a passionate community of developers and users. FreeCAD is another excellent option, particularly if your focus is on engineering and product design. It's a parametric 3D modeler, meaning you can easily modify your designs by changing parameters. This is crucial for creating precise and accurate models for manufacturing or architectural purposes. FreeCAD supports a wide range of file formats, making it compatible with other CAD software. Its modular architecture allows you to add functionality through plugins, further extending its capabilities. While it might not be as visually flashy as Blender, FreeCAD's strength lies in its technical precision and robust feature set for engineering applications. Finally, we have Sculptris, a fantastic entry point into the world of 3D sculpting. This user-friendly software, developed by Pixologic (the makers of ZBrush), is designed to mimic the feel of working with digital clay. You can push, pull, and smooth the surface of your model to create organic shapes and intricate details. Sculptris is perfect for creating characters, creatures, and other organic forms. Its intuitive interface makes it easy to pick up, even if you have no prior 3D modeling experience. Plus, it's a great stepping stone to more advanced sculpting software like ZBrush. These free and open-source options prove that you don't need to break the bank to get started with 3D modeling. They offer a solid foundation for learning the fundamentals and exploring your creative potential.

Commercial 3D Modeling Software: Industry Standards and Specialized Tools

When it comes to commercial 3D modeling software, you're stepping into a realm of powerful, feature-rich applications that are often considered industry standards. These tools come with a price tag, but they also offer advanced capabilities, robust support, and seamless integration with other software in professional workflows. Let's explore some of the key players in this arena. Autodesk Maya is a name that resonates throughout the 3D industry. It's a comprehensive software package used for modeling, animation, simulation, and rendering. Maya is particularly popular in the film, television, and game development industries, known for its versatility and powerful toolset. It's capable of handling complex projects with ease, from creating realistic character animations to building intricate environments. The learning curve can be steep, but the rewards are significant. Mastering Maya opens doors to a wide range of professional opportunities. 3ds Max, also from Autodesk, is another industry giant, particularly strong in architectural visualization and game development. While it shares some similarities with Maya, 3ds Max has a different workflow and interface, catering to a slightly different user base. It's known for its robust modeling tools, powerful rendering capabilities, and extensive plugin support. 3ds Max is a favorite among architects and designers for creating photorealistic renderings of buildings and interiors. Cinema 4D, developed by Maxon, is known for its user-friendly interface and powerful motion graphics capabilities. It's a popular choice for designers creating visual effects, motion graphics, and 3D animations. Cinema 4D strikes a good balance between power and usability, making it accessible to both beginners and experienced users. Its seamless integration with Adobe After Effects makes it a staple in the motion graphics industry. ZBrush, from Pixologic, is the undisputed king of digital sculpting. This software is specifically designed for creating highly detailed organic models, such as characters, creatures, and props. ZBrush's unique sculpting workflow allows artists to create intricate details that would be difficult or impossible to achieve with traditional modeling techniques. It's widely used in the film, game development, and collectible industries. Rhino, or Rhinoceros 3D, is a NURBS-based modeling software known for its precision and accuracy. It's a popular choice for industrial design, architecture, and jewelry design. Rhino's strength lies in its ability to create smooth, curved surfaces, making it ideal for designing products with complex shapes. These commercial options represent the pinnacle of 3D modeling technology. While they require a significant investment, they offer the power and features necessary for professional-level work.

Factors to Consider When Choosing 3D Modeling Software: Making the Right Choice for You

Choosing the right 3D modeling software is a personal decision, and there's no one-size-fits-all answer. It depends on your individual needs, goals, and preferences. To help you make the best choice, let's consider some key factors. Your experience level is a crucial starting point. If you're a complete beginner, diving straight into a complex software like Maya might be overwhelming. Starting with a more user-friendly option like Tinkercad or Sculptris can help you grasp the fundamentals before moving on to more advanced tools. On the other hand, if you have prior 3D modeling experience, you might be ready to tackle a more challenging software with a steeper learning curve. Your specific goals are another critical consideration. What do you want to create? Are you interested in character modeling, architectural visualization, product design, or 3D printing? Different software excels in different areas. For example, ZBrush is a top choice for character sculpting, while FreeCAD is well-suited for engineering applications. Thinking about your desired outcome will help narrow down your options. Budget is, of course, a significant factor. As we've discussed, there are many excellent free and open-source options available, but commercial software often offers advanced features and support. Consider whether the cost of a commercial license is justified by the benefits it provides for your specific needs. Many commercial software companies offer subscription-based pricing models, which can make the software more accessible on a monthly or annual basis. The features offered by the software are also essential. Make a list of the features that are most important to you, such as specific modeling tools, rendering capabilities, animation features, or file format support. Compare the features offered by different software to see which best aligns with your requirements. Ease of use is a subjective but important factor. Some software is known for its intuitive interface and user-friendly workflow, while others have a steeper learning curve. Consider your learning style and how much time you're willing to invest in mastering the software. Many software companies offer trial versions, which can be a great way to test out the interface and workflow before committing to a purchase. Finally, consider the community and support available for the software. A strong online community can be a valuable resource for learning, troubleshooting, and getting inspiration. Look for software with active forums, tutorials, and documentation. Excellent customer support from the software vendor can also be crucial, especially when you encounter technical issues. By carefully considering these factors, you can confidently choose the 3D modeling software that's the perfect fit for your creative journey.

Tips for Learning 3D Modeling: From Beginner to Pro

Okay, you've chosen your 3D modeling software – awesome! Now, the real fun begins: learning how to use it and bringing your ideas to life. Whether you're starting from scratch or looking to level up your skills, here are some tips for learning 3D modeling: Start with the fundamentals. Before diving into complex projects, make sure you have a solid understanding of the basic principles of 3D modeling. This includes concepts like vertices, edges, faces, polygons, and different modeling techniques. Many online resources and tutorials cover these fundamentals, so take the time to learn them thoroughly. Practice, practice, practice! This is the golden rule of any skill, and 3D modeling is no exception. The more you use the software, the more comfortable and proficient you'll become. Start with simple projects and gradually increase the complexity as you improve. Don't be afraid to experiment and make mistakes – that's how you learn! Follow tutorials. The internet is a treasure trove of 3D modeling tutorials, ranging from beginner-friendly introductions to advanced techniques. YouTube, Vimeo, and various online learning platforms offer a wealth of free and paid tutorials. Find tutorials that focus on the specific skills you want to learn or the type of projects you want to create. Join a community. Connecting with other 3D modelers can be incredibly helpful. Online forums, communities, and social media groups provide a space to ask questions, share your work, get feedback, and learn from others. The 3D modeling community is generally very supportive and welcoming to newcomers. Set realistic goals. Don't expect to become a 3D modeling master overnight. It takes time, effort, and dedication to develop your skills. Set achievable goals for yourself and celebrate your progress along the way. Break down larger projects into smaller, more manageable tasks. Don't be afraid to fail. Mistakes are a natural part of the learning process. Don't get discouraged if your first models don't look perfect. Learn from your mistakes and keep practicing. Every error is an opportunity to improve. Find inspiration. Look at the work of other 3D artists and designers to get inspired. Study their techniques and try to replicate them in your own work. Collect references for your projects, such as photos, sketches, and other 3D models. Stay curious and keep learning. The world of 3D modeling is constantly evolving, with new software, techniques, and trends emerging all the time. Stay curious, keep exploring, and never stop learning. The more you learn, the more creative and skilled you'll become.
